Heart drug fails to shield duchenne boys from cardiac decline

NCT ID NCT01648634

First seen Nov 20, 2025 · Last updated Jun 05, 2026 · Updated 18 times

Summary

This study tested whether nebivolol, a beta-blocker heart drug, could prevent heart failure in 51 boys aged 10-15 with Duchenne muscular dystrophy. Participants had normal heart function at the start and were randomly given either nebivolol or a placebo. The trial found that nebivolol did not prevent the development of heart problems compared to placebo.
